Comprehending Bariatric Foldable Electric Wheelchairs

Bariatric electric wheelchairs are particularly developed to accommodate users with a higher weight capability. Unlike basic wheelchairs, these designs are engineered with enhanced frames, broader seats, and powerful motors efficient in supporting higher weight without compromising performance. The foldable feature makes them practical for travel, storage, and transportation-- a vital aspect for users who are constantly on the move.

Key Features of Bariatric Foldable Electric Wheelchairs

FeatureDescription
Weight CapacityNormally supports weights ranging from 300 to 600 pounds, dealing with different user needs.
Seat WidthLarger seats (frequently 22 inches or greater) offer boosted convenience and assistance.
Motors and RangeGeared up with robust motors that provide a variety of up to 15 miles on a single charge.
FoldabilityCreated for simple folding, permitting compact storage and transport in vehicles.
ToughnessConstructed with top quality products to hold up against everyday wear and tear, ensuring long-term usage.
AdjustabilityFeatures adjustable armrests, footrests, and backrests to accommodate different body types.

Advantages of Bariatric Foldable Electric Wheelchairs

  1. Enhanced Mobility: These wheelchairs provide individuals with mobility difficulties higher flexibility to navigate their environments, whether inside or outdoors.
  2. Improved Comfort: The design prioritizes user comfort, with functions such as cushioned seating and assistance for the back, which is necessary for prolonged usage.
  3. Mobility: The foldable nature of these electric wheelchairs enables easy transportation, making it easier to take a trip or spend days out without hassle.
  4. Safety Features: Many designs include advanced safety features such as anti-tip technology, responsive braking systems, and lights for exposure, guaranteeing users can navigate in various environments securely.
  5. Cost-Effectiveness: Investing in a bariatric electric wheelchair can reduce the requirement for expensive adjustments to living environments or transport approaches.

Considerations When Choosing a Bariatric Foldable Electric Wheelchair

When picking the ideal wheelchair, a number of aspects need to be considered:

ConsiderationExplanation
User's Weight and HeightMake sure the wheelchair can accommodate the user's weight and height easily.
Terrain RequirementsConsider where the wheelchair will be mostly utilized-- smooth indoor surface areas versus rugged outside paths.
Battery LifeExamine the battery life and charging time to ensure it meets day-to-day needs.
Personalization OptionsTry to find options to personalize seating and manages according to individual convenience and requirements.
Warranty and SupportConsider the producer's guarantee and offered support for repairs or upkeep.
DevicesCheck out if additional accessories (e.g., bags, cup holders) are available to enhance usability.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. Are bariatric foldable electric wheelchairs covered by insurance?

Lots of insurance suppliers cover electric wheelchairs if they are considered clinically essential. It is vital to talk to your insurance company about specific protection information and requirements.

2. How heavy are bariatric foldable electric wheelchairs?

The weight of a bariatric electric wheelchair differs depending upon the design and features. Nevertheless, they typically range from 100 to 150 pounds, which can affect transportation capabilities.

3. How do I keep my electric wheelchair?

Routine maintenance includes charging the battery properly, checking tire pressure, lubing moving parts, and ensuring that the electronic devices are working properly.

4. Can I utilize a bariatric electric wheelchair outdoors?

Yes, numerous bariatric electric wheelchairs are created for both indoor and outdoor usage, but it's crucial to pick a model that matches your specific terrain requirements.

5. The length of time does the battery last on a typical charge?

Battery life varies by design but usually varies from 10 to 20 miles on a complete charge. Users should review specs to ensure their selected wheelchair fulfills their mobility needs.
